About Dimitrios Koutsonikolas

Dimitrios Koutsonikolas is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ering and Human-Computer Interaction, having authored 128 papers that have together received 3.1k indexed citations. Recurring topics across this work include Wireless Networks and Protocols (60 papers), Advanced MIMO Systems Optimization (38 papers), Millimeter-Wave Propagation and Modeling (28 papers), Cooperative Communication and Network Coding (28 papers), Mobile Ad Hoc Networks (27 papers), Indoor and Outdoor Localization Technologies (17 papers), Advanced Wireless Network Optimization (11 papers) and Caching and Content Delivery (11 papers). The work is most often cited by research in Computer Networks and Communications (1.7k citations), Electrical and Electronic Engineering (2.2k citations) and Signal Processing (367 citations). Dimitrios Koutsonikolas has collaborated with scholars based in United States, Spain and Mexico. Frequent co-authors include Y. Charlie Hu, Saumitra M. Das, Yu Hu, Souvik Sen, Chih-Chun Wang, Zhi Sun, Swetank Kumar Saha, Kyu-Han Kim, Sun Li and Josep Miquel Jornet. Their work appears in journals such as IEEE Journal on Selected Areas in Communications, IEEE Communications Magazine and IEEE Transactions on Wireless Communications.
